13th Jun' 2021 (Evening)

  • Both Nifty and BankNifty opened higher on Friday. They started seeing selling and saw a sharp intraday fall.
  • However, Nifty picked up support at 15750 and recovered almost all losses and closed 3 points above the opening level of 15796. This was coincidentally also its previous all time high level of 15800. It ended making a Doji type of a candle on the daily chart, indicating some uncertainty.
  • BankNifty on the other hand corrected a bit deeper and did not recover as much as Nifty. It ended up making a bearish candle on the daily chart. While BankNifty opened outside the downward channel formed over the past couple of trading sessions, it quickly came in and closed within this channel.
  • FII bought marginally for 18 Cr. FII have been buying and selling alternatively over the past few days. While DII have been mostly sellers over the past few days. I see a pattern of buying by DII at lower levels, supporting the markets. 
  • DII seems to be powered with some fresh liquidity coming in from the domestic retails investors. The domestic mutual funds have seen a capital influx.
  • VIX on the other hand is on a historical low level. Now at 14.1
  • A quick analysis of the VIX on a daily chart shows bottoming out. Though it doesn't mean, an immediate reversal. It may however, see an increase in some upcoming sessions. So as usual, citing the market levels and the uncharted territory Nifty is in, I advice lighter positions and hedging.  
  • There has been a reduction in the intraday volumes, this could be driven by the margin capping or due to a completely unified stand on the bullishness in the market.
  • My experience is that when there is an opinion of one sided movement in the market, the movement actually is on the other side. I can be wrong though. Well, lets see.
  • US markets are also showing uncertainty. Dow on Friday closed making a Doji candle again. The intraday movements in US have also been lower in the past few days. S&P VIX closed at 18.85 on Friday. Again, at lowest levels over the last one year.
  • After the inflation concerns in this week. Investors and traders are now looking at the FED meeting on Wednesday, and US economic data on PPI, Industrial production and retails sales on Tuesday. Well this would be a day before our weekly closing on Thursday. So watch it. 
  • On the domestic front, Covid cases have been decreasing everyday and more and more states are declaring reopening, these are good positives for us.
  • Options data shows a strong support for Nifty at 15700 for this week and 35000 for BankNifty.
  • Looking at flat markets and lower VIX, mostly straddles are written by option writers. 15800 for Nifty and 35000 for BankNifty. Looking at the premium of these straddles. 15650-15950 is the trading range for Nifty and 34400-35600 for BankNifty for the current week.

1. FII were net buyers for 18 Cr today, while DII were buyers for 666 Cr. A net buying of 684 Cr from the institutional side.

2. FII's unwound 2876 longs and unwound 1224 shorts on the indices

3. On the option front FII  sold 70865 calls and   sold 30273 puts. They also bought 57788 calls and  bought 36789 Puts.

4. For next week expiry, Nifty has the highest OI for PE at 15700 followed by 15800 and highest OI for CE is at 16000 followed by 15800. Highest Put writing was seen at 15800 and highest call writing was seen at 15800 levels.

5. For the next week expiry, Bank Nifty has the highest OI for PE at 35000 followed by 34500 and highest OI for CE is at 35500 followed by 35000. Highest Put writing was seen at 35000 and highest call writing was seen at 35000 levels. 

6. Asian markets closed mixed and Europe closed in green on Friday

7. US markets closed flat on Friday

8. The breadth of the market was weak

9. Nifty opened at 15796 and made an intra day high of 15835 and a low of 15749 before closing at 15799 .The range of Nifty for the day was 86 points.

10. Bank Nifty opened at 35324 and made an intra day high of 35344 and a low of 34891 before closing at 35047 .The range of Nifty for the day was 453 points.

11. US Dollar Index is trading at 90.527

12. Metals, IT, Pharma and Energy were positive today and others closed in red.

13. India VIX reduced to 14.1

14. US 10Y yields are at 1.454

15. Nifty futures saw long buildup

16. Bank Nifty saw short build up
